
The “75 Hard” challenge became a huge hit on TikTok in recent years, and it made a comeback at the start of 2025. Many people are turning to it in an attempt to build mental strength and discipline, but what if it’s too intense for your taste? We’re here to help you put a soft twist on the “75 Hard” challenge and make its strict set of rules more manageable.
Rule 1: Follow a diet of your choosing
Since this rule isn’t extremely specific, it’s quite easy to follow. It’s up to you to decide what a healthy diet looks like but keep in mind you also shouldn’t have any cheat meals or drink alcohol.
Rule 2: Two 45-minute workouts daily
If you’re at the very start of your fitness journey, two 45-minute workouts per day may not sound manageable. Stick to one 45-minute workout per day, or try to do two shorter workouts.
Rule 3: Drink a gallon of water every day
Drinking a full gallon aka 3.8 liters of water per day may seem too excessive even if you don’t have trouble staying hydrated. Kick things off by drinking eight glasses of water or 2 liters daily, and see if your body is craving more.
Rule 4: Read 10 pages of non-fiction
You don’t have to be an avid reader to follow this rule because it can completed pretty quickly. Pick a non-fiction book that explores a subject you’re truly interested in, and you’ll read 10 pages in no time.
Rule 5: Take progress pictures
This step is also quite manageable because gym photos can help you keep track of your progress and keep you motivated to stick to the rest of the “75 Hard” rules.
